What is stump grinding?

A special machine can be used to grind the stump. The grinder reduces the wood into small chips and mulch.

The importance of stump grinding

  • The stump is typically reduced to 6-12″ below the surface of the ground.
  • There are still some roots, but they will eventually decay.
  • After grinding the area, it can be covered with soil, grass, or landscaping.

This method is quick, efficient and does not cause as much disruption to the area.

Benefits of Stump Grinding

  1. The roots remain in the ground, so there is less digging and disturbance of nearby landscaping.
  2. Grinding is cheaper than total removal because it requires less labor and equipment.
  3. Fast Turnaround The process can be completed in a matter of hours.
  4. Eco-Friendly: Wood chips can be used as mulch or compost.

Benefits of Stump Removal

  1. Complete Elimination No chance of regrowth or roots interfering with future landscaping.
  2. Fresh Start: Ideal for replanting a tree or building a structure in the same place.
  3. Long-term Solution: Prevents decay of underground roots, which could cause uneven ground.
